Currency Auction Results, 2nd May

By John Lee. The Central Bank of Iraq (CBI) has reported that 26 banks and 20 remittance companies took part in its currency auction on Monday. A total of $96,077,314 sold at a price of 1182 Iraqi Dinars (IQD) per dollar. (Source: Central Bank of Iraq)

Currency Auction Results, 28th Apr

By John Lee. The Central Bank of Iraq (CBI) has reported that 28 banks and 22 remittance companies took part in its currency auction on Thursday. A total of $121,558,416 sold at a price of 1182 Iraqi Dinars (IQD) per dollar. (Source: Central Bank of Iraq)
